A registered apprenticeship is a career that allows the apprentices to earn a salary as they train.
Launched in 2020, the Partnership on Inclusive Apprenticeship (PIA) has advanced policies and practices to improve access to inclusive career pathways and talent pipelines. You start an apprenticeship with on-the-job training, followed by short periods of in-class technical training as your apprenticeship progresses. Offers $2,000 total per person to help apprentices after they complete their apprenticeship training. After you complete both the in-class and on-the-job training, you can apply for your journeyperson certification.
